Triethyl Phosphonoacetate is primarily recognized for its utility in the Horner-Wadsworth-Emmons (HWE) reaction, a powerful method for synthesizing alkenes with excellent stereochemical control. In drug discovery, the precise construction of carbon-carbon double bonds is often essential for mimicking natural products, creating specific pharmacophores, or establishing the correct three-dimensional structure of a drug candidate. The ability of Triethyl Phosphonoacetate to generate phosphonate carbanions that react with carbonyls to form alkenes, often with a preference for the E-isomer, makes it an invaluable tool in the synthetic chemist's arsenal.

As a pharmaceutical intermediate, Triethyl Phosphonoacetate is crucial for building the molecular frameworks of various drugs. Its applications span across different therapeutic areas, including the synthesis of antiviral agents, where phosphonate moieties can mimic nucleotide structures to inhibit viral replication. It is also integral in creating compounds with antibacterial and anticancer activities, often by incorporating phosphonate groups that can interact with biological targets. Moreover, the versatility of Triethyl Phosphonoacetate allows it to be used in the preparation of chiral phosphonates, which are vital for asymmetric synthesis – a field of immense importance in modern medicinal chemistry. The ability to synthesize enantiomerically pure compounds is often critical, as different enantiomers of a drug can have vastly different pharmacological effects.
